"Drew Adams" <drew.adams@oracle.com> writes:

> ``region'' in the main menu should be just region - or possibly
> "region", if you consider that this somehow defines a region (which I
> don't). AFAIK, there is never a need for ``...'' in Info.

I think this looks OK the way it is.  It's introducing a concept that
most newbies won't be familiar with.

> Same thing for ``edit'' in the same node.

Ditto.

> Also, ``Shifted motion keys'' in node Setting Mark.

That one looked rather odd, yes.  I've rewritten it.

> Also, ``GNU Free Documentation License'' in the node of the same name.
>
> There are no other occurrences of `` in the Emacs manual, AFAICT.

Eg.:

In the combination, you must combine any sections Entitled ``History''
in the various original documents, forming one section Entitled
``History''; likewise combine any sections Entitled ``Acknowledgements'',
and any sections Entitled ``Dedications''.  You must delete all
sections Entitled ``Endorsements.''

And so on.  So I think I'll leave that one alone, too.
